hai i have some problem when running flume
the error is
+ exec /usr/bin/java -Xmx1024m -cp
'/opt/service/conf:/data/apache-flume-1.5.2-bin/lib/*' -Djava.library.path=
org.apache.flume.node.Application --conf-file
/data/apache-flume-1.5.2-bin/conf/top-agent-mobile1.conf --name httpagent-m1
log4j:WARN No appenders could be found for logger
(org.apache.flume.lifecycle.LifecycleSupervisor).
log4j:WARN Please initialize the log4j system properly.
log4j:WARN See http://logging.apache.org/log4j/1.2/faq.html#noconfig for
more info.
i'm running flume with command
/data/apache-flume-1.5.2-bin/bin/flume-ng agent -n httpagent-m1 -c conf -f
/data/apache-flume-1.5.2-bin/conf/top-agent-mobile1.conf --name
httpagent-m1
any suggest what i must suppose to do ?

It's a warning that it's not finding the log4j configuration file, the real
problem is that probably is not finding any of the other configuration
files but you don't see the errors.
I think the issue might be with "-c conf", I kinda remember is relative to
the bin directory like this "../conf"; if you put the absolute path it
should work.
